Honda removed the rear glass hatch

The vehicle has all nice features but they got rid of the very useful openable rear glass in 2016 re-design. I owned Toyota highlander which still has rear window openable feature. I used it everyday like daily grocery shopping and on trips. You don't need to open the whole back door for grabbing a small item. Also it was very helpful to load/unload without opening my garage door. Moreover you get more space by filing the cargo through the hatch window when the rear door is closed. If I ever sell/trade my pilot, this would be the only reason.

1st time Honda Pilot Owner (2019 Honda Pilot EX-L)

Well, I've owned this vehicle for less then a month so everything is great so far. It has a lot of space for the family. We transitioned from a Honda Odyssey to the Pilot, essentially to get the AWD without compromising the space we need. I've owned three brand new vehicles, all Hondas, basically for the reliability of the vehicle. So, I hope it keeps up with their standards. Most of these SUVS look alike in this class but the Honda seems to have a bit more room, although others are getting bigger as well. The vehicle has a great ride and handling. It's tech screen is superb and all the options in this years model are standard as far as Honda sensing. It's pretty cool. Again, all these vehicles are similar to some degree as they copycat from each other. Liked It, didn't fit well.

I really liked this vehicle and might have bought it except for two things: 1.) limited left leg room up front and 2.) a funky adjustable arm rest. I am a long-legged guy and felt that the left foot pad on the driver's side was a little too close. Additionally, whereas in my past cars there was a space between the foot rest and the brake pedal where I could extend my (often achy) left leg, there was no such space in the Pilot. Thus, I could not offset the problem of the too-close foot rest. Also, the armrest was annoying in that it was awkward to reach and if you adjusted it wrongly you had to start over again since it is ratchet style. Also, for me, it was too small and too close to the body. I like to be able to spread out when I drive. Since I am a frequent distance driver, these are, unfortunately, dis-qualifiers for me. Otherwise, it is a very nice car with great cabin storage.
